How Much Does a Service Operations Specialist Make in New Mexico?

Updated March 01, 2025
As of March 01, 2025, the average annual pay of Service Operations Specialist in New Mexico is $41,871. While Salary.com is seeing that Service Operations Specialist salary in NM can go up to $51,923 or down to $32,980, but most earn between $37,217 and $47,132.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, and your experience levels. Top 10 Highest Paying Cities For Service Operations Specialist Jobs in New Mexico

It is important to understand how location impacts your career prospects in the United States. There are some cities where a Service Operations Specialist can find a job easily with a greater salary paid then achieve a higher standard of living. Below is the top cities list for Service Operations Specialist job salaries in New Mexico. Some cities can pay higher salaries for Service Operations Specialist jobs, which can indicate that there is a large demand for Service Operations Specialist positions in this city.
The following table shows top 10 cities where the Service Operations Specialist salary is higher than other cities in New Mexico. Santa Fe takes first place in this list, followed by Albuquerque, Rio Rancho. The Service Operations Specialist salary is $42,915 in Santa Fe, which is lower than the national average. There is 0 city's Service Operations Specialist salary higher than national average in New Mexico.
The average salary for a Service Operations Specialist in New Mexico is $41,871, but we found that the city with the highest salary for Service Operations Specialist jobs is Santa Fe, NM, and it is higher than Albuquerque. Service Operations Specialist jobs in Santa Fe can have the opportunity to earn higher salaries than in other cities in New Mexico.
CITY ANNUAL SALARY MONTHLY PAY WEEKLY PAY HOURLY WAGE
Santa Fe $42,915 $3,576 $825 $21
Albuquerque $42,688 $3,557 $821 $21
Rio Rancho $42,552 $3,546 $818 $20
Farmington $42,143 $3,512 $810 $20
Clovis $40,554 $3,379 $780 $19
Alamogordo $40,508 $3,376 $779 $19
Hobbs $40,191 $3,349 $773 $19
Roswell $39,827 $3,319 $766 $19
Sunland Park $39,555 $3,296 $761 $19
Las Cruces $39,328 $3,277 $756 $19
